Hip roof shingle repair services focus on fixing issues specific to homes with a hip roof design, which features slopes on all four sides that come together at the top to form a ridge. This type of repair typically involves replacing damaged or missing shingles, sealing leaks, and addressing any underlying structural concerns that may compromise the roof’s integrity. Skilled service providers assess the condition of the shingles and underlying materials to determine the best course of action, ensuring that the roof remains weather-tight and visually appealing. Proper repair can extend the lifespan of a hip roof and prevent more costly problems down the line.

Common problems addressed by hip roof shingle repair include cracked, curling, or missing shingles caused by weather exposure, aging, or improper installation. Leaks are another frequent concern, often resulting from damaged shingles or compromised flashing around vents and chimneys. Over time, shingles may also deteriorate due to moss, algae growth, or wind damage, which can weaken the roof’s protective layer. Repair services help resolve these issues by replacing damaged shingles, resealing vulnerable areas, and ensuring that all components function together to keep water out and maintain the roof’s structural support.

The overview below groups typical Hip Roof Shingle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Montgomery County, PA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or hip roof shingle repairs range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as replacing a few damaged shingles, fall within this range. Fewer projects extend beyond this band unless additional work is needed.

Moderate Repairs - More extensive repairs, including fixing multiple damaged areas or addressing underlying issues, usually cost between $600 and $1,500. Many local contractors handle these mid-range projects regularly, with costs varying based on the scope.

Major Repairs - Larger, more complex repairs, such as extensive shingle replacement or structural reinforcement, can range from $1,500 to $3,500. Projects in this range are less common but are necessary for significant damage or aging roofs.

Full Replacement - Complete shingle roof replacement on a standard-sized home typically costs between $7,000 and $15,000. Larger or more elaborate projects can exceed this range, with many local service providers able to handle these larger jobs efficiently.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
